Note: The sewing studio has (2) rooms, each with (30) students. Every station has its own 4 foot table, and, each room is outfitted with (4) ironing and pressing stations. You will not be able to have an iron at your own personal station, but with your own personal table, you will have some space to complete much of your trimming needed during the paper piecing process in your quilt.

Rainbow Hosta Queen The Rainbow Hosta Queen marks the launch of a series of patterns using new units designed to fit the original Fire Island Hosta and Fire Island Hosta Queen layout. When all of the patterns are published you’ll be able to mix and match units from each design to create your own unique quilt pattern using an upcoming subscription service called Quiltster.
This color layout was designed using Quiltster by Judel Niemeyer Buls. Quiltster is set to launch in the Spring 2016. Clamshell Clamshell is here! We’ve added the traditional shell block to our collection of foundation paper pieced patterns. With the shell, New York Beauty arcs, long spikes (with floating points), and sashing, this quilt incorporates many techniques that are very popular with those who love our patterns. Bali Pops Strip SetQuiltworx.com with Hoffman Fabrics of California are rolling out our latest generation of Bali Pops fabrics hand selected by Judy Niemeyer. The 2 strip sets include 48 2-1/2″ strips per group. These sets are designed to complement many of our quilt designs, especially our wedding ring patterns. Bali Wedding Star With this latest release of the Bali Wedding Star pattern, we’ve updated the instructions to our new standards including Smart Corners making assembly easier than ever. Solar Flares Solar Flares was designed by Quiltworx in 2015 as an addition to our collection of patterns that use the (48) pack of 2-1/2” strips that Quiltworx has created, involving pre-sorting and pre-packaging strips in six groups of 8, ranging from light to dark in color value. The design utilizes a block that is familiar to Quiltworx fans, originally used in the Raindrops pattern. The instructions have been adapted for a scrappy layout using 2-1/2” strips and a collection of (36) background fabrics (the pattern requires 1/4 Yard of each!). Grandma’s Wedding Ring This Grandma’s Wedding Ring showcases our Wildflowers Collection fabric line, and uses two different techniques for foundation paper piecing. A technique called Foundation Strip Piecing is used to piece the Wedding Ring arcs. Traditional piecing is used to assemble four squares for the background units. Traditional curved piecing is required to assemble the arcs, centers, and melons.

Prismatic Star The latest release of our Prismatic Star pattern showcases the new Hoffman Bali Pops strip set JNBP3, hand selected by Judy. The blue quilt uses Group 1, while the cream quilt uses Group 2. The strip piecing process for the Prismatic Star was designed for foundation paper piecing. Strips are sewn onto foundation paper to complete what we call a ‘Strip Set’. After the strip sets are completed they are cut apart, rearranged and resewn into a diamond star point. Splash

![]() Kalispell, MT Judy is an international instructor known for her foundation paper piecing techniques and quilt patterns. Her company, Judy Niemeyer Quilting Inc., has published over 100 foundation paper pieced quilt patterns over the last 15 years. Her quilts and patterns have become well-known both nationally and internationally among quilters and quilt shop owners. The patterns include many sewing techniques commonly referred to as foundation paper piecing, traditional piecing, curved piecing, strip piecing, and appliqué. |
